Not logged in | Red-breasted Nuthatch(Sitta canadensis)
Photo taken by Patrick Beauzay The Red-breasted Nuthatch was first counted in 1916 (count year 17) and the latest data we have is in 2011 (count year 112). It has been tallied 1,717 times in 119 locations. A total of 30,698 birds have been counted. The highest count was 748 birds enumerated in Duluth in 2009.
